The Ambassador
photo of David ShearEarlham alumnus David Shear '75 has been confirmed as the United States' ambassador to Vietnam. Shear says he entered the foreign service “completely by chance,” though he says that his study of Japan as an Earlham student clearly had something to do with it.continue reading
